
Mission of the Central Institute of Information Technologies
The mission of the Center for Social Research is to develop applied social research and expert-analytical activities aimed at forming scientifically based decisions in the field of socio-economic and political development of society and the state.
Goals and objectives of the CIO
In accordance with the Regulation, the main objectives of the Central Information Center are:
- development of applied research in the field of sociological and political sciences, expert-analytical and consulting services;
- implementation of a strategic project to create a sustainable national system for monitoring and evaluating (long-term research) public opinion of the population of the Kyrgyz Republic – «Kyrgyz Barometer»;
- creation of a multifunctional base for strengthening the practical training of bachelors, masters, postgraduate students, doctoral students and young researchers in the fields of sociology and political science;
- transformation into a «think tank» (Think-Tank) in the medium term;
- involvement of faculty in applied research, data processing and analysis, and the preparation of high-quality scientific publications;
- Promoting the K. Karasaev BSU among the expert community, other analytical centers, government agencies, and public and international organizations.
To achieve this goal, the Central Information Center performs the following tasks (and provides services to interested parties):
• organizes and conducts sociological, socio-economic, political science and other types of social research in various spheres of society on a wide range of issues, including for interested parties on a commercial basis;
• conducts long-term monitoring and evaluation of public opinion in relation to socio-economic, political and other processes occurring in the state, region and world;
• provides expert analytical and consulting services to interested parties on the development of scientifically based management decisions, development programs and strategies, and forecasts;
• prepares analytical reports (reports, justifications, analytical notes, policy briefs, etc.) based on the collection and generalization of diverse sociological, political, socio-economic and other information;
• conducts training and educational events (lectures, trainings, master classes, seminars, webinars, etc.) on issues of organizing and conducting applied sociological, socio-economic, political science and other types of research;
• conducts scientific, practical and expert events (round tables, congresses, conferences, symposiums, etc.) on various social issues;
• creates and develops a sociological database and archives of public opinion polls, introduces modern digital research methods based on leading global experience;
• popularizes sociological and political science knowledge and research results in society through publicly available information channels (mass media, social media).
